Sketch Measure兼容性问题解决与团队协作指南
2026-03-11 02:52:07作者:翟萌耘Ralph
在设计团队协作过程中,跨版本兼容问题常常成为效率瓶颈。本文将系统讲解如何诊断、解决Sketch Measure插件在不同macOS环境下的兼容性问题,帮助团队建立高效协作流程,提升设计交付质量与效率。
问题诊断:识别系统兼容性状况
系统版本检测方法
要解决兼容性问题,首先需要明确当前系统环境。通过以下两种方式可以快速获取系统版本信息:
命令行检测:
sw_vers -productVersion
此命令将返回当前macOS版本号,如"13.4"表示Ventura系统
图形界面查看:
- 点击屏幕左上角苹果图标
- 选择"关于本机"
- 查看"版本"信息
兼容性状态评估
根据系统版本,可以将兼容性状态分为以下几类:
- 完全兼容(macOS 11.x-13.x):所有功能正常运行,性能表现最佳
- 部分兼容(macOS 10.15):核心功能可用,但部分高级特性可能受限
- 有限兼容(macOS 10.14及以下):仅基础测量功能可用,可能出现频繁卡顿
⚠️注意:使用有限兼容系统的团队成员应考虑升级,以避免影响协作效率。
解决方案:针对性配置策略
新版系统优化配置(macOS 12.x-13.x)
适用场景:设计师主力工作环境,追求最佳性能表现
实施步骤:
- 打开Sketch应用,通过
⌥ + return快捷键调出插件面板 - 点击"设置"按钮进入配置界面
- 勾选"启用硬件加速"选项
- 将"导出质量"调整为"最佳"模式
- 点击"保存"并重启Sketch
验证方法:
- 执行一次完整的设计规范导出
- 检查导出文件是否完整
- 观察操作过程中是否有卡顿现象
旧版系统兼容方案(macOS 10.14-10.15)
适用场景:开发人员或老旧设备,需要保证基础功能可用
手动操作方式:
- 关闭Sketch应用
- 打开"终端"应用
- 输入以下命令启用兼容性模式:
defaults write com.bohemiancoding.sketch3 "measure.compatibilityMode" -bool true
- 输入以下命令禁用硬件加速:
defaults write com.bohemiancoding.sketch3 "measure.disableHardwareAccel" -bool true
- 重新启动Sketch应用
验证方法:
- 创建简单画板并添加测量标记
- 导出基础规范文档
- 确认文档在其他设备上可正常打开
常见问题解决方案
插件无法加载
症状:Sketch启动时提示"插件加载失败"
解决步骤:
- 打开Sketch偏好设置(
⌘ + ,) - 进入"插件"选项卡
- 找到"Sketch Measure"并点击"移除"
- 从官方源重新安装插件
- 重启Sketch应用
💡技巧:重新安装前建议清理插件缓存文件,路径为~/Library/Application Support/com.bohemiancoding.sketch3/Plugins
导出功能异常
症状:点击导出按钮后无反应或导出文件损坏
预防措施:
- 确保导出路径不包含中文或特殊字符
- 保持至少1GB可用磁盘空间
- 定期清理Sketch缓存(
~/Library/Caches/com.bohemiancoding.sketch3)
协作规范:团队统一配置指南
角色适配配置
不同角色的团队成员应采用不同的配置策略:
设计师配置:
- 推荐系统:macOS 12.x或更高版本
- 核心设置:启用硬件加速,最佳导出质量
- 维护任务:每周检查插件更新,每月清理缓存
开发人员配置:
- 推荐系统:macOS 10.15或更高版本
- 核心设置:启用兼容性模式,标准导出质量
- 维护任务:定期验证设计规范显示效果
产品经理配置:
- 推荐系统:任意支持Sketch的macOS版本
- 核心设置:只读模式,禁用自动更新
- 维护任务:仅在必要时更新插件版本
文件交接规范
设计文件在团队内流转前,应完成以下检查:
- 确认所有画板尺寸符合规范要求
- 检查图层命名遵循团队统一标准
- 验证所有测量标记正确无误
- 测试导出文件在目标系统上可正常打开
- 压缩包命名格式:
项目名_版本号_日期.sketch
优化策略:提升性能与稳定性
导出效率优化
精简设计文件:
- 删除未使用的参考画板
- 合并重复的图形元素
- 清理隐藏图层和空组
导出设置优化:
- 导出时临时关闭实时预览
- 选择合适的导出格式(PNG适用于图片,SVG适用于图标)
- 按功能模块分批导出,避免单次导出过大文件
常见误区澄清
| 错误认知 | 正确理解 |
|---|---|
| "版本越高越好" | 新版本可能引入兼容性问题,应选择团队统一的稳定版本 |
| "插件功能越多越好" | 仅启用必要功能可提升性能,减少冲突 |
| "缓存清理不重要" | 定期清理缓存可预防多数加载和导出问题 |
未来规划:长期兼容性保障
系统升级路径
团队应制定有序的系统升级计划:
-
评估阶段(1-2周)
- 测试当前工作流在目标系统的兼容性
- 识别潜在问题和解决方案
-
试点阶段(2-4周)
- 选择小部分团队成员先行升级
- 收集反馈并调整配置方案
-
全面推广(1-2周)
- 安排全体成员完成系统升级
- 提供必要的技术支持
持续维护机制
建立插件兼容性维护机制:
- 指派专人负责跟踪插件更新
- 每月进行一次跨版本兼容性测试
- 建立问题反馈与解决方案知识库
- 制定插件版本回滚应急方案
核心知识点总结
- 兼容性模式(Compatibility Mode):针对旧系统优化的运行模式,牺牲部分功能换取稳定性
- 硬件加速(Hardware Acceleration):利用GPU提升图形处理性能的技术,新版系统推荐启用
- 缓存清理(Cache Cleaning):定期删除临时文件以预防插件异常的维护操作
- 规范导出(Specification Export):将设计文件转换为开发可用规范文档的核心功能
- 跨版本测试(Cross-version Testing):在不同系统环境验证插件功能的质量保障措施
通过本文介绍的方法,团队可以有效解决Sketch Measure的兼容性问题,建立高效协作流程,提升设计到开发的交付效率。记住,技术工具的价值在于服务于人,合理的配置和规范的流程才是团队协作的真正基石。
登录后查看全文
热门项目推荐
相关项目推荐
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ust075-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00
热门内容推荐
最新内容推荐
项目优选
收起
暂无描述
Dockerfile
690
4.46 K
Ascend Extension for PyTorch
Python
546
670
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
955
929
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ed.
Get Started
Rust
425
75
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
407
326
昇腾LLM分布式训练框架
Python
146
172
本项目是CANN开源社区的核心管理仓库,包含社区的治理章程、治理组织、通用操作指引及流程规范等基础信息
650
232
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
564
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.59 K
925
TorchAir 支持用户基于PyTorch框架和torch_npu插件在昇腾NPU上使用图模式进行推理。
Python
642
292